Output 4b6f633c71b1bb7047730185bec73c7d5b5c8d39ca01e0a454384073f260b42a:0

value
27384909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ed4f9eec81495bdb24f2be1a9a73da28308030ad OP_EQUAL
address
3PKoTA5zi6CyExepTNoFzFVdh5NUXiPdEs
transaction
4b6f633c71b1bb7047730185bec73c7d5b5c8d39ca01e0a454384073f260b42a
confirmations
303496
spent
true